Sun Feb 21 17:21:53 CST 2010 make[1]: Entering directory `/sources/gawk-3.1.7' Making check in libsigsegv make[2]: Entering directory `/sources/gawk-3.1.7/libsigsegv' Making check in src make[3]: Entering directory `/sources/gawk-3.1.7/libsigsegv/src' make[3]: Nothing to be done for `check'. make[3]: Leaving directory `/sources/gawk-3.1.7/libsigsegv/src' Making check in tests make[3]: Entering directory `/sources/gawk-3.1.7/libsigsegv/tests' make check-TESTS make[4]: Entering directory `/sources/gawk-3.1.7/libsigsegv/tests' Test passed. PASS: sigsegv1 Test passed. PASS: sigsegv2 Doing SIGSEGV pass 1. Stack overflow 1 caught. Doing SIGSEGV pass 2. Stack overflow 2 caught. Test passed. PASS: sigsegv3 Starting recursion pass 1. Stack overflow 1 caught. Starting recursion pass 2. Stack overflow 2 caught. Test passed. PASS: stackoverflow1 /bin/sh: line 5: 970 Segmentation fault ${dir}$tst FAIL: stackoverflow2 =================== 1 of 5 tests failed =================== make[4]: *** [check-TESTS] Error 1 make[4]: Leaving directory `/sources/gawk-3.1.7/libsigsegv/tests' make[3]: *** [check-am] Error 2 make[3]: Target `check' not remade because of errors. make[3]: Leaving directory `/sources/gawk-3.1.7/libsigsegv/tests' make[3]: Entering directory `/sources/gawk-3.1.7/libsigsegv' Now please type 'make install' to install the package. make[3]: Leaving directory `/sources/gawk-3.1.7/libsigsegv' make[2]: *** [check-recursive] Error 1 make[2]: Target `check' not remade because of errors. make[2]: Leaving directory `/sources/gawk-3.1.7/libsigsegv' Making check in . make[2]: Entering directory `/sources/gawk-3.1.7' make 'CFLAGS=-g -O2' 'LDFLAGS=-export-dynamic' check-local make[3]: Entering directory `/sources/gawk-3.1.7' make[3]: Nothing to be done for `check-local'. make[3]: Leaving directory `/sources/gawk-3.1.7' make[2]: Leaving directory `/sources/gawk-3.1.7' Making check in awklib make[2]: Entering directory `/sources/gawk-3.1.7/awklib' make[2]: Nothing to be done for `check'. make[2]: Leaving directory `/sources/gawk-3.1.7/awklib' Making check in doc make[2]: Entering directory `/sources/gawk-3.1.7/doc' make[2]: Nothing to be done for `check'. make[2]: Leaving directory `/sources/gawk-3.1.7/doc' Making check in po make[2]: Entering directory `/sources/gawk-3.1.7/po' make[2]: Leaving directory `/sources/gawk-3.1.7/po' Making check in test make[2]: Entering directory `/sources/gawk-3.1.7/test' Any output from "cmp" is bad news, although some differences in floating point values are probably benign -- in particular, some systems may omit a leading zero and the floating point precision may lead to slightly different output in a few cases. Locale environment: LC_ALL="C" LANG="C" ======== Starting basic tests ======== addcomma anchgsub argarray arrayparm arrayprm2 arrayprm3 arrayref arrymem1 arryref2 arryref3 arryref4 arryref5 arynasty arynocls aryprm1 aryprm2 aryprm3 aryprm4 aryprm5 aryprm6 aryprm7 aryprm8 arysubnm asgext awkpath back89 backgsub childin clobber closebad clsflnam compare compare2 concat1 concat2 concat3 concat4 convfmt datanonl defref delarpm2 delarprm delfunc dynlj eofsplit exitval1 exitval2 fldchg fldchgnf fnamedat fnarray fnarray2 fnaryscl fnasgnm fnmisc fordel forsimp fsbs fsrs fsspcoln fstabplus funsemnl funsmnam funstack getline getline2 getline3 getlnbuf getnr2tb getnr2tm gsubasgn gsubtest gsubtst2 gsubtst3 gsubtst4 gsubtst5 gsubtst6 hex hsprint inputred intest intprec iobug1 leaddig leadnl litoct longsub longwrds manglprm math membug1 messages minusstr mmap8k mtchi18n nasty nasty2 negexp nested nfldstr nfneg nfset nlfldsep nlinstr nlstrina noeffect nofile nofmtch noloop1 noloop2 nonl noparms nors nulrsend numindex numsubstr octsub ofmt ofmtbig ofmtfidl ofmts onlynl opasnidx opasnslf paramdup paramres paramtyp parse1 parsefld parseme pcntplus prdupval prec printf0 printf1 prmarscl prmreuse prt1eval prtoeval psx96sub rand rebt8b1 redfilnm regeq reindops reparse resplit rs rsnul1nl rsnulbig rsnulbig2 rstest1 rstest2 rstest3 rstest4 rstest5 rswhite scalar sclforin sclifin sortempty splitargv splitarr splitdef splitvar splitwht strcat1 strnum1 strtod subamp subi18n subsepnm subslash substr swaplns synerr1 synerr2 tradanch tweakfld uninit2 uninit3 uninit4 uninitialized unterm uparrfs wideidx wideidx2 widesub widesub2 widesub3 widesub4 wjposer1 zero2 zeroe0 zeroflag ======== Done with basic tests ======== ======== Starting Unix tests ======== fflush getlnhd localenl pid pipeio1 pipeio2 poundbang space strftlng ======== Done with Unix tests ======== ======== Starting gawk extension tests ======== argtest backw badargs binmode1 clos1way devfd devfd1 devfd2 fieldwdth fsfwfs funlen fwtest fwtest2 gensub gensub2 getlndir gnuops2 gnuops3 gnureops icasefs icasers igncdym igncfs ignrcas2 ignrcase lint lintold manyfiles match1 match2 match3 mbprintf3 mbstr1 nondec nondec2 posix printfbad1 printfbad2 procinfs rebuf regx8bit reint reint2 rsstart1 rsstart2 rsstart3 rstest6 shadow This test could fail on slow machines or on a minute boundary, so if it does, double check the actual results: strftime strtonum ======== Done with gawk extension tests ======== ======== Starting machine-specific tests ======== double1 ./double1.ok _double1 differ: char 1, line 1 make[2]: [double1] Error 1 (ignored) double2 ./double2.ok _double2 differ: char 247, line 4 make[2]: [double2] Error 1 (ignored) fmtspcl intformat ./intformat.ok _intformat differ: char 1, line 1 make[2]: [intformat] Error 1 (ignored) ======== Done with machine-specific tests ======== ======== Starting tests that can vary based on character set or locale support ======== asort asorti fmttest fnarydel fnparydl lc_num1 mbfw1 mbprintf1 mbprintf2 rebt8b2 sort1 sprintfc whiny ======== Done with tests that can vary based on character set or locale support ======== make[3]: Entering directory `/sources/gawk-3.1.7/test' 3 TESTS FAILED make[3]: Leaving directory `/sources/gawk-3.1.7/test' make[2]: Leaving directory `/sources/gawk-3.1.7/test' make[1]: *** [check-recursive] Error 1 make[1]: Target `check' not remade because of errors. make[1]: Leaving directory `/sources/gawk-3.1.7'